Classical. Brazilian. R&B. Jazz. Afro-Cuban. Popular Rock and Roll. Ed Johnson’s mastery of so many different styles, coupled with a passion for harmony vocal and horn arrangements, all factor into a magical blend of vibrant, original contemporary jazz that is winning fans and airplay worldwide.
As a vocalist, Ed Johnson is frequently compared to Ivan Lins, Milton Nascimento, Kenny Rankin, and Michael Franks. As a guitarist and bandleader, critics often cite the lushly exotic, accessible sounds of Airto and Flora Purim. Ed has seven recording projects to his credit, in addition to producer’s credits for other singer/songwriters.

Boasting an illustrious cast of musicians who’ve performed around the world with a dizzying array of talent, from Ray Charles and Taj Mahal to Pharoah Sanders and Bobby Hutcherson, The Jazz Therapists only play for exclusive audiences.
The Jazz Therapists are a group of stellar Bay Area musicians who have been playing their unique swinging arrangements from the great American songbook, jazz standards and forgotten gems since 2015.
Boasting an illustrious cast of musicians who have performed and recorded with a dizzying array of talent, from Ray Charles and Taj Mahal, to Pharaoh Saunders and Bobby Hutcherson, to Kenny Barron, and KD lang, to Calvin Keyes and Julian Priester.
The band has one of the Bay Area’s busiest sidemen, drummer David Rokeach, on piano Ben Stolorow and first-call bassist Mark Heshima Williams. Trombonist and ace arranger Mike Rinta, who earned a 2014 Grammy award with the Pacific Mambo Orchestra, supplies the majority of the charts. Mike and tenor sax player Lincoln Adler were featured in the horn section of Taj Mahal’s acclaimed recent “Savoy” album. Together they are “The Jazz Therapists!”

Five Ten was born out of the hearts and minds of renowned Oakland musicians: Keyboardist, Composer Steve Carter, multi-Percussionist Marquinho Brasil, and Dennis Smith, Bass Guitarist, Composer. Together with internationally known and Grammy nominated Jeff Narell on steel pans, and Santana alumnus Billy Johnson on drums, Five Ten is a musical explosion that soothes, excites and electrifies. Fifty years ago, the Pacifica Arts & Heritage Council, the predecessor of Pacifica Performances, started hosting live music performances at the Pedro Point Firehouse. Over time, we had to find other venues to hold our concerts, which were at Saint Edmunds Church, and the Pacifica Community Center, before finding a home of our own as part of the Pacifica Center for the Arts. In 2010, to commemorate our first Artistic Director, we named our hall the Mildred Owen Concert Hall.
